<p>We are back for 2024 (better late than never) with an interesting talk about female genital cutting (previously known as FGM - female genital mutilation) with <a href='https://www.arragejenkins.com.au/dr-greg-jenkins'>Dr Greg Jenkins.</a></p> <p>Today’s episode is a tough but important episode. We discuss female genital cutting previously known as female genital mutilation in Australia. We have had the absolute privilege of talking to<a href='https://www.arragejenkins.com.au/dr-greg-jenkins'> Dr Greg Jenkins,</a> who was an OBGYN at Auburn hospital when they were first confronted with women in labour who had immigrated from countries where this cultural tradition continues. They looked around for pregnancy and birth guidelines for this population of women but couldn’t find any, so went about creating them, with some exceptional outcomes for these women. </p> <a href='https://www.arragejenkins.com.au/dr-greg-jenkins'>Dr Jenkins</a> currently heads up Obstetrics and Gynaecology at Westmead Public hospital in Sydney, and works privately at Norwest Private hospital in Sydney. We had a brilliant chat with <a href='https://www.womanlynd.com/meetus'>Dr Stephanie Pirotta</a> about PCOS (polycystic ovary syndrome) and the role of lifestyle interventions to manage the chronic illness. This episode was meant to be aired before the PB Endo Conference, where Dr Pirotta presented a wonderful talk, however Lori's life was crazy and she just couldn't pull it together and get it out there in time. Apologies! But this episode is such a great listen. Dr Stephanie Pirotta is an accredited Dietician, Nutritionist and Researcher - She has a PhD in PCOS and doing post-doctoral work at <a href='https://research.monash.edu/en/persons/stephanie-pirotta'>Monash University</a> in the space of diet, PCOS, endometriosis and fertility. Stephanie is the founder of <a href='https://www.womanlynd.com/'>Womanly Nutrition and Dietetics </a>in Melbourne. Enjoy!
